Ebay message requiring me to verify bank info I've had for over a year

I have received an apparent ebay message on my main ebay page requiring me to verify my existing bank info that I've been using without a problem for over a year or I cannot use my account.  They want me to log in to my bank account from that page.  Seems a little hinky to me...

Ebay message requiring me to verify bank info I've had for over a year

Nothing hinkey!

 

When you click the button to verify a new window will pop up, what's in the pop up is the log in page for YOUR bank.

 

eBay never sees the log-in information you use there only your bank has access to that page, once you log-in the bank confirms to eBay that is has been successful and that proves that YOU control that bank account and that you have given permission for eBay to access the account.

 

It's the standard way that is used to give third-party authorizations online.
